Finnebassen gives us some "Homework" we will actually enjoy

In 2012, Norwegian house mastermind Finnebassen burst onto the dance scene with “If You Only Knew” and “Touching Me,” gaining support from likes of Pete Tong and Hot Since 82. Now, Finnebassen returns with “Homework,” a nine-minute track worthy of study.

With the intro, Finnebassen sets the theme of growing that permeates the entire track. After more than two minutes, when the beat finally drops in, it is apparent that “Homework” is not just another dance track, but instead it is an ethereal experience, ready to transport the listener to another plane. A driving, yet soft beat keeps the track moving while Finnebassen showcases a stunning melody with some emotive pad work. The buildup thorough the track is palpable and lends to feeling of musical transport along this journey. This is definitely a track deserving of more study and definitely another listen.
